Navigating the U.S. immigration system can be a complex and daunting process, especially for those seeking a Green Card. A Green Card grants lawful permanent resident status, which allows individuals to live and work in the United States indefinitely. Given the intricacies of immigration law and the high stakes involved, hiring a Green Card immigration lawyer is essential to ensure your success in obtaining U.S. residency. First and foremost, an immigration lawyer is an expert in U.S. immigration law, and their knowledge of the various pathways to a Green Card can be invaluable. Whether you are applying through family sponsorship, employment, asylum, or through the Diversity Visa Lottery, a lawyer can help you navigate the specific requirements for each category. With numerous eligibility criteria and strict documentation requirements, a lawyer will ensure that you meet all the necessary conditions and present your case in the best possible light. One of the biggest challenges applicants face is understanding the paperwork and the various forms required throughout the Green Card process.

Immigration applications can involve extensive documentation, including personal records, evidence of relationships, financial statements, and more. A Green Card immigration lawyer can assist with organizing and submitting the correct documents in the right order, helping you avoid costly mistakes that could delay or jeopardize your application. Moreover, the process of securing a Green Card often requires multiple steps, including interviews, medical examinations, and background checks. Each of these steps comes with its own set of rules and potential obstacles. An experienced immigration lawyer will guide you through every phase of the process, providing you with a clear understanding of what to expect and preparing you for any challenges that may arise. In addition to their legal expertise, immigration lawyers are also well-versed in the potential risks and complications that may arise during the application process. For example, if you have a criminal record, prior immigration violations, or issues with inadmissibility, a Green Card immigration lawyer can help you understand how these factors might impact your case and what steps you can take to mitigate any negative effects.

They can also help you explore options for waivers or exceptions, which can be critical to securing your Green Card.
